Dependency is a major issue in many industries, and the tech industry is no exception. Recently, both Zillow and Lyft have experienced issues related to atozmp3 dependency on third-party services, highlighting the importance of managing dependencies in software development.
Zillow, the popular real estate website, recently experienced a major outage that lasted for several hours. The outage was caused by a dependency on a third-party service that was used to manage the website’s infrastructure. When the third-party service experienced issues, Zillow’s website was unable to function properly, causing toonily frustration for users and impacting the company’s bottom line.
Similarly, Lyft, the popular ride-sharing service, experienced a major outage in 2019 that was caused by a dependency on a third-party service. The outage lasted for several hours and impacted millions of users, causing significant frustration for those who rely on Lyft for transportation.
The issues experienced by Zillow and Lyft highlight the importance of masstamilanfree managing dependencies in software development. When companies rely too heavily on third-party services, they run the risk of being impacted by issues outside of their control. This can result in downtime, lost revenue, and frustration for users.
In order to prevent dependency-related issues, companies need to take steps to manage their dependencies effectively. This includes:
- Identifying critical dependencies: Companies need to identify the third-party services that are critical to their operations and prioritize them accordingly. This will help them to focus their efforts on managing the most important dependencies and to mitigate the risks associated with those dependencies.
- Monitoring dependencies: Companies need to masstamilan monitor their dependencies closely in order to identify potential issues before they become major problems. This can include monitoring for changes in API behavior, changes in service availability, and other factors that could impact the company’s operations.
- Having backup plans: Companies need to have backup plans in place in case their critical dependencies experience issues. This can include having redundant systems in place, having alternative services that can be used in case of an outage, and other measures that can help to minimize the impact of dependency-related issues.
The issues experienced by Zillow and Lyft also justprintcard highlight the importance of transparency in the tech industry. When companies experience issues related to dependencies, they need to be transparent with their users and stakeholders about the cause of the issue and the steps that are being taken to address it. This can help to build trust with users and can also help to prevent similar issues from occurring in the future.